Mango growers, producers, consultants and agronomists in the horticulture sector are invited to two Mango Research and Development (R&D) Forums on Wednesday 9 May and Thursday 10 May.

The Department of Primary Industry and Resources (DPIR) and the Northern Territory Farmers Association (NTFA) will host the two forums – in Darwin and Thursday 10 May in Katherine – and invite your input to the future direction of our R&D.

These forums will benefit anyone involved in the mango industry and will discuss recent results with the researchers who are exploring mango production, including research on:

  • nutrition and fruit quality
  • precision technologies such as remote sensing, sensor technologies and machine learning
  • magpie geese
  • flowering and market chain research
  • insect pests, IPM and chemical control
  • export activities.

DPIR and NTFA will be introducing our new mango extension staff who will work to build this capacity. Representatives from the Australian Mango Industry Association and Hort Innovation will be attending to discuss the new mango industry RD&E project to build capacity in the Australian mango industry.
